The Board approved adding 10 firefighter positions to the 2025 city budget and transferring funds from the contingent fund to cover salaries. Officials said the positions are intended to improve response times, meet mandatory staffing needs, and reduce overtime, which had exceeded $3 million over the previous two years.

Mount Vernon will add 10 firefighters, giving the department more staff to cover shifts, planned promotions, and employee time off. City officials said this should improve emergency response and reduce overtime costs, while continuing to monitor staffing and spending. The board also approved staff attendance at a free Laserfiche training workshop.
